Infotainment
‘Infotainment’, a portmanteau of ‘information’ and ‘entertainment’ gives passengers both relevant journey information as well as access to entertainment services, such as television, music and radio in order to increase passenger experience. Passenger Information
Passenger information, given to passengers on dedicated passenger information displays or directly to their smartphones via apps etc. allows passengers to plan their journeys, find out timetables and get information about delays, cancellations or other disruptions. Operators can additionally use these displays or services to generate additional revenue by selling advertising space. Surveillance & CCTV
Surveillance and CCTV solutions are designed to keep passengers and staff safe and assets such as vehicles and infrastructure protected by acting as a deterrent. These can be on board buses or at bus stops. In addition, this area covers body-worn CCTV cameras, which can capture both audio and video. CCTV technology also assists in the management and investigation of major incidents and in traffic monitoring. Ticketing
Ticketing comprises both hardware and software, from paper tickets to card readers and ticket vending machines on the one hand and reservation and ticketing software and apps on the other. Paperless tickets are becoming increasingly commonplace, with smart ticketing – tickets that can be loaded on to smartcards or mobile phones – becoming the norm. Wi-Fi
Smartphones and other portable devices such as tablets and laptops have become ubiquitous. Passengers using the public transport network now expect to access wifi during their journey for leisure or work purposes. Operators not only increase their attractiveness to potential passengers by providing free wifi, they can also use it to gather insightful data on their customers.
